Therapeutic approaches for anxiety and relationship work online

Acceptance and Commitment Therapy helps people notice unhelpful thoughts and choose actions that match their values. It can be useful for anxiety and life changes by focusing on small, value‑driven steps rather than trying to eliminate difficult feelings. Cognitive Behavioural Therapy looks at how thoughts, feelings and behaviours interact and teaches practical strategies to shift unhelpful patterns. It often helps with stress, anxiety and sleep problems by breaking problems into manageable parts.

Online sessions are offered by video call, phone, live chat or text‑based messaging to make therapy more flexible. Video calls suit deeper conversation and visual connection while phone sessions can be easier when bandwidth is low. Live chat or text messaging can be used for brief check‑ins or ongoing coaching between sessions. These options let people fit therapy around work, caregiving and everyday life.
